AIM: Determine levels of sIgA, IgG, IgA in vaginal secretion and saliva of women of reproductive age with chronic inflammatory diseases of small pelvis organs (IDSPO) at exacerbation stage and remission period. MATERIALS AND METHODS: Clinical-laboratory and gynecological examination of 105 women was carried out. Based on the results obtained 3 groups were formed: patients with IDSPO at exacerbation stage; patients at remission stage; clinically healthy women. sIgA, IgG, IgA parameters were studied in vaginal secretion and saliva in women with IDSPO at exacerbation stage and remission period by radial immune diffusion in gel by Manchini method. RESULTS: An increase of immunoglobulin level in vaginal secretion of women with IDSPO at remission period and a sharper increase of these parameters during exacerbation of the disease compared with women of the control group were detected. During analysis of sIgA, IgG, IgA levels in saliva in the same groups of women the results were obtained that give evidence that the presence of IDSPO and local immune reaction do not lead to the changes of these parameters. CONCLUSION: The obtained parameters on the dependence of an increase of immunoglobulin levels in vaginal secretions and the degree of intensity of the inflammatory process give basis to use them with the aim of additional diagnostics.

AIM: Determine subpopulation composition of blood lymphocytes and the level of expression of TLR2 and TLR9 by epithelial cells of cervical canal mucous membrane in women of reproductive age with inflammatory disease of small pelvis organs (IDSPO) at exacerbation stage and remission period. MATERIALS AND METHODS: Clinical-laboratory and gynecological examination of 105 women was carried out and 3 groups were formed based on the results: patients at IDSPO exacerbation stage; patients at remission stage; clinically healthy women. By using real time PCR, TLR2, TLR9 gene expression levels were determined in epithelial cells of cervical canal mucous membrane in women of all the 3 groups. Subpopulation composition of blood lymphocytes was determined by flow cytofluorimetry by using monoclonal antibodies with CD45+ CD3+ -T-cell, CD45+ CD3+ CD4+ -T-helper, CD45+, CD3+, CD8+ -T-suppressors-cytotoxic killers, CD45+, CD3-, CD16+, CD56+ natural killers, CD45+, CD3-, CD19+ -B-lymphocytes. Immune fluorescence reaction evaluation was carried out in flow cytofluorimeter Cytomics FC 500 (Becton Coulter, USA). RESULTS: The level of expression of TLR2 gene in the studied groups of patients was established not to differ significantly from parameters in the comparison groups, however it should be noted that this parameter in women with IDSPO at exacerbation stage (causative agents of the infectious process--ureaplasma, staphylococcus, candida) was somewhat higher than in the comparison group. Significantly high level of TLR9 gene expression in cervical canal epithelial cells was detected to correlate with the presence of infectious causative agents. In the group of women with exacerbation of the infectious process the expression of TLR9 was 14.5 times higher compared with the group of women without IDSPO. Among groups of women with IDSPO significant differences in relation to control group in relative and absolute levels of CD3+ T-lymphocytes; CD4+ T-helpers; CD8+ cytotoxic killer T-suppressors, B-lymphocytes compared with the same parameters in clinically healthy women were not detected. CONCLUSION: The increase of TLR9 gene expression level in cervical canal cells of women with IDSPO may serve as an additional diagnostic feature of the presence and degree of severity of the disease.
